What Happened to David Lawrence Ramsey III?

Dave Ramsey is an American personal finance expert, author, and radio host who built an empire, Ramsey Solutions, after recovering from personal bankruptcy in his late twenties. He is widely known for his "Baby Steps" approach to debt elimination and wealth building, and continues to host "The Ramsey Show" and lead Ramsey Solutions, which offers financial education, tools, and advice to millions. As of 2026, he remains a prominent figure in personal finance, though his company has faced recent legal challenges regarding endorsements.

David Lawrence Ramsey III, born September 3, 1960, in Maryville, Tennessee, embarked on an entrepreneurial path early, buying and selling real estate in his late teens and early twenties. By age 26, he had amassed a real estate portfolio valued at over $4 million. However, a sudden recall of his promissory notes by a new lender led to his filing for Chapter 7 bankruptcy in 1988. This personal financial crisis became the crucible for his future career, as he dedicated himself to understanding and teaching sound money management principles.

In 1991, Ramsey began offering financial counseling sessions at his church, which quickly grew into a professional endeavor. He founded The Lampo Group in 1991 (later rebranded as Ramsey Solutions in 2014), aiming to provide biblically based, common-sense financial education. His first book, "Financial Peace," was self-published in 1992, the same year he launched his local radio show, "The Money Game," which evolved into the nationally syndicated "The Dave Ramsey Show" by 1999. In 1994, he introduced Financial Peace University (FPU), a nine-lesson course designed to guide individuals and families out of debt and towards financial stability.

Ramsey's financial philosophy, centered on his "Baby Steps" plan, advocates for strict budgeting, aggressive debt repayment (the "debt snowball"), building an emergency fund, and investing for retirement. He is a staunch critic of credit cards and advocates for cash-based transactions. This straightforward, often firm, approach has resonated with millions, establishing Ramsey Solutions as a major player in the financial education industry. The company, headquartered in Franklin, Tennessee, employs over 1,000 people and generates substantial annual revenue, with "The Ramsey Show" reaching more than 20 million listeners weekly across various platforms as of 2026.

In recent years, Ramsey and Ramsey Solutions have faced scrutiny and legal challenges. Notably, in June 2023, a $150 million lawsuit was filed against Ramsey and his company by listeners who alleged they were defrauded by Timeshare Exit Team, an advertiser on "The Ramsey Show." The lawsuit claims Ramsey received over $30 million between 2015 and 2021 to promote the company, which allegedly failed to deliver on its promises and engaged in deceptive practices. Timeshare Exit Team had previously shut down in 2021 after a settlement over deceptive promises. This ongoing litigation represents a significant challenge to Ramsey's brand and business model.

As of June 11, 2026, Dave Ramsey remains actively involved in his media empire. He continues to host "The Ramsey Show," offering advice on a range of financial topics, including recent discussions on mortgage refinancing, car purchases, and navigating IRS debt through programs like Innocent Spouse Relief. Ramsey Solutions also continues to publish new content, such as the "2026 Ramsey Goal Planner," and provides economic outlooks for the year. His net worth is estimated to be around $250 million, with some reports suggesting it could be higher, reflecting his continued influence and the success of Ramsey Solutions.

People Also Ask

What is Dave Ramsey's net worth in 2026?
As of early 2026, Dave Ramsey's net worth is estimated at approximately $250 million, primarily accumulated through Ramsey Solutions, his bestselling books, radio syndication, digital education platforms, speaking engagements, and real estate investments.
Is Dave Ramsey still on the radio in 2026?
Yes, Dave Ramsey continues to host his nationally syndicated radio program, "The Ramsey Show," which is heard by over 20 million listeners weekly on more than 600 radio stations and various digital platforms as of 2026.
What is Financial Peace University (FPU) and is it still active in 2026?
Financial Peace University (FPU) is a nine-week course created by Dave Ramsey that teaches biblical, practical steps for managing money, getting out of debt, and building wealth. It remains active in 2026, with classes offered virtually and in-person, and is a core offering of Ramsey Solutions.
What recent controversies has Dave Ramsey faced?
In June 2023, Dave Ramsey and Ramsey Solutions were hit with a $150 million lawsuit. Listeners alleged they were defrauded by Timeshare Exit Team, a company advertised on 'The Ramsey Show,' which had previously settled over deceptive promises in 2021.
What is Ramsey Solutions?
Ramsey Solutions is the company founded by Dave Ramsey in 1991 (originally as The Lampo Group). It provides biblically based, common-sense financial education and empowerment through various products, including "The Ramsey Show," Financial Peace University, books, and digital tools. As of April 2026, it employs approximately 1,400 people.
